Get started38 Millbrook Avenue is a three-bedroom detached house in Denton, Manchester, Manchester (M34 2DQ). It has a recorded floor area of 119 m² (around 1281 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(December 2013) shows a D (score 56), a step below the typical UK home.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since November 2010. Between certificates, l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 73). The latest certificate is from December 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include attached land beyond the plot.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.
One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2004.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. At 119 m² it's 17.2% larger than the typical home in the postcode (102 m² median across 16 E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£442,000 is 33.9%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£258/sq ft) was about 52.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old December 2021 for £330,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
